ECAL Bachelor Industrial Design students present miniature versions of furniture pieces designed by Vico Magistretti in the exhibition Vico Magistretti and Japan in Milan.
ANNOUNCEMENT
At the 61st Venice Biennale, the Swiss Pavilion presents The Unfinished Business of Living Together, an exhibition conceived by a collective that includes Yul Tomatala, a graduate of ECAL’s Bachelor’s program in Photography, and Miriam Laura Leonardi, a faculty member in the Bachelor’s program in Visual Arts.
ANNOUNCEMENT
After over than ten years as head of the Bachelor Industrial Design, Stéphane Halmaï-Voisard will hand over responsibility for the program to Camille Blin, director of the Master Product Design program.
ANNOUNCEMENT
In keeping with the legacy of Milo Keller, whose passing deeply affected the school, Calypso Mahieu and Clément Lambelet have been appointed to lead ECAL’s Photography programmes.
